Kai is your always-on incident response coordinator. He monitors alerting systems (PagerDuty, Datadog, Grafana), triages incoming incidents by severity, assembles the right responders, maintains a real-time incident timeline, and ensures communication flows to stakeholders throughout resolution. After every significant incident, Kai drafts a blameless post-mortem with root cause analysis, timeline reconstruction, and actionable follow-up items. He transforms chaotic incident response into a structured, repeatable process.
What Kai does
Alert Monitoring & Triage
Ingests alerts from monitoring tools, deduplicates, correlates related alerts, and assigns severity levels.
Incident Coordination Engine
Maintains incident timeline, assigns roles, tracks action items, and posts status updates to communication channels.
Post-Mortem Generator
Drafts blameless post-mortem documents with timeline, root cause analysis, and follow-up action items.
